Some of us are getting together Friday, July 11, 2008 to hang out on the beach by Seaside Johnnies in Rye. If you would like to join us, bring a blanket or chair, food to gnosh on, and a beverage of your preference.
This event has been popular in the past with Wine and Dine Group and I have gone many times and have had a great time.

We are meeting on the beach at 6:30 PM. When you enter the beach, walk to the left. We will be by the lifeguard stand near the jetty. We can watch the Playland fireworks from the beach which starts at 9:15 PM and then decide what to do from there.

Parking at the Seaside Johnnies/Oakland Beach parking lot is $5.


Weather permitting. Check your e-mail on the WineDineguide Westchester Dining and Fun Group website on Friday afternoon after 3 PM to see if the event is cancelled. If you DON'T see a cancellation, the event is still on.

DIRECTIONS TO OAKLAND BEACH PARKING LOT (AND TO OUR MEETING SPOT)

From the Bronx, Pelham, New Rochelle, Larchmont
Take 95 North ( The New England Thruway ) to Exit 19 which is the Rye Playland Exit. You will get on Playland Parkway to Forest Avenue which is just in front of Playland. At Forest Avenue you will make a Right and take that to Dearborn Avenue where you will make a Left into the parking lot.

From Connecticut
Take 95 South to Exit 19 which is the Rye Playland Exit. You will get on Playland Parkway to Forest Avenue which is just in front of Playland. At Forest Avenue you will make a Right and take that to Dearborn Avenue where you will make a Left into the parking lot.


From the other side of Westchester ( i.e. Dobbs Ferry ) and Northern Westchester ( i.e. Armonk )
Take 287 West to the New England Thruway ( 95 South ) to Exit 19 which is the Rye Playland Exit. You will get on Playland Parkway to Forest Avenue which run in front of Playland. At Forest Avenue you will make a Right and take that to Dearborn Avenue where you will make a Left into the parking lot.

Coming locally - a la Boston Post Road
Going North on Boston Post Road. Go to the light at Oakland Beach Avenue and make a Right - go straight until you can go no further at which point you will make a right and then the first Left and then enter the parking lot.

Going South on Boston Post Road. Go to Oakland Beach Avenue and make a Left hand turn - go straight until you can go no further at which point you will make a right and then the first Left and then enter the parking lot.

DIRECTIONS TO THE MEETING SPOT ON THE BEACH FROM SEASIDE JOHNNIES PARKING LOT
Once you park in the lot, walk down to the beach. The entrance to the beach is just to the left of Seaside Johnnies. When you enter the beach, walk to the left. We will be by the lifeguard stand near the jetty.
